public int InsertOrUpdate(B2b_com_roomtype model) { using (var sql = new SqlHelper()) { try { var internalData = new InternalB2b_com_roomtype(sql); int result = internalData.InsertOrUpdate(model); return(result); } catch { throw; } } }
public int InsertOrUpdate(B2b_com_roomtype model) { var cmd = sqlHelper.PrepareStoredSqlCommand(SQLInsertOrUpdate); cmd.AddParam("@Id", model.Id); cmd.AddParam("@Name", model.Name); cmd.AddParam("@Bedtype", model.Bedtype); cmd.AddParam("@Wifi", model.Wifi); cmd.AddParam("@ReserveType", model.ReserveType); cmd.AddParam("@Builtuparea", model.Builtuparea); cmd.AddParam("@Floor", model.Floor); cmd.AddParam("@Bedwidth", model.Bedwidth); cmd.AddParam("@Whetherextrabed", model.Whetherextrabed); cmd.AddParam("@Extrabedprice", model.Extrabedprice); cmd.AddParam("@Largestguestnum", model.Largestguestnum); cmd.AddParam("@Whethernonsmoking", model.Whethernonsmoking); cmd.AddParam("@Amenities", model.Amenities); cmd.AddParam("@Mediatechnology", model.Mediatechnology); cmd.AddParam("@Foodanddrink", model.Foodanddrink); cmd.AddParam("@ShowerRoom", model.ShowerRoom); cmd.AddParam("@Breakfast", model.Breakfast); cmd.AddParam("@Sms", model.Sms); cmd.AddParam("@Sortid", model.Sortid); cmd.AddParam("@Server_type", model.Server_type); cmd.AddParam("@Pro_type", model.Pro_type); cmd.AddParam("@Source_type", model.Source_type); cmd.AddParam("@Createuserid", model.Createuserid); cmd.AddParam("@Createtime", model.Createtime); cmd.AddParam("@Whetheravailabel", model.Whetheravailabel); cmd.AddParam("@Roomtyperemark", model.Roomtyperemark); cmd.AddParam("@Comid", model.Comid); cmd.AddParam("@Roomtypeimg", model.Roomtypeimg); cmd.AddParam("@RecerceSMSName", model.RecerceSMSName); cmd.AddParam("@RecerceSMSPhone", model.RecerceSMSPhone); var parm = cmd.AddReturnValueParameter("ReturnValue"); cmd.ExecuteNonQuery(); return((int)parm.Value); }